Read moreThe WeatherShield1 is able to read temperature, pressure and humidity values from the environment. It’s equipped with a microcontroller that manages sampling and performs moving average on the last 8 samples. It’s connected to the Arduino board though a synchronous bidirectional serial protocol similar to what was implemented in the MM5450 LED driver.
